@charset "utf-8";

.top-contents-left a:hover img{
	filter: alpha(opacity=75); /*For IE*/
	opacity: 0.75; /*Opera・Safari*/
	-moz-opacity: 0.75; /*For FireFox*/
}


.top-contents-left img.img-rightthumb{
    margin-top:0;
	margin-bottom:2em;
    padding-left:2em;
    float:right;
}

.top-contents-left ul{
	list-style-type:none;
	text-align:left;
}

.top-contents-left li{
	margin-bottom:10px;
	margin-left:20px;
	padding-left:17px;
	background:url(../image/arrow-back.gif) left 3px no-repeat;
	text-align:left;
}

.top-contents-left li.last-li{
	margin-bottom:30px;
	margin-left:20px;
	padding-left:17px;
	background:url(../image/arrow-back.gif) left 3px no-repeat;
	text-align:left;
}

.top-contents-left blockquote{
	border:1px solid #009245;
	background-color:#ECFFEC;
	padding:15px;
}



.top-contents-left table{
	margin:0 auto 30px;
	width:700px;
	border-collapse:collapse;
	border:solid 1px #999999;
}

.top-contents-left th{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
}

.top-contents-left td{
	border:solid 1px #999999;
	padding:5px;
	text-align:left;
}

/*中央区*/
.top-contents-left th.chuo-kyoiku{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:230px;
}

/*港区*/
.top-contents-left th.minato-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:220px;
}

.top-contents-left th.minato-kyoiku{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:200px;
}

/*文京区*/
.top-contents-left th.bunkyo-kyoiku{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:60px;
}

/*渋谷区*/
.top-contents-left th.shibuya-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:130px;
}

/*墨田区*/
.top-contents-left th.sumida-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:125px;
}

/*江東区*/
.top-contents-left th.koto-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:130px;
}

.top-contents-left th.koto-kosodate02{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:190px;
}

/*荒川区*/
.top-contents-left th.arakawa-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:125px;
}

/*足立区*/
.top-contents-left th.adachi-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:125px;
}

/*葛飾区*/
.top-contents-left th.katsushika-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:125px;
}

/*江戸川区*/
.top-contents-left th.edogawa-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:130px;
}

/*品川区*/
.top-contents-left th.shinagawa-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:130px;
}

.top-contents-left th.shinagawa-kosodate02{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:80px;
}

.top-contents-left th.shinagawa-kosodate03{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:400px;
}

/*目黒区*/
.top-contents-left th.meguro-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:135px;
}

/*大田区*/
.top-contents-left th.ohta-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:135px;
}

/*中野区*/
.top-contents-left th.nakano-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:200px;
}

/*杉並区*/
.top-contents-left th.suginami-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:135px;
}

/*豊島区*/
.top-contents-left th.toshima-kosodate{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:195px;
}

.top-contents-left th.toshima-kyoiku{
	border:solid 1px #999999;
	background-color:#eeffee;
	padding:5px;
	width:175px;
}